RBA buys more of May 2028 govt bonds

By Sophia Rodrigues

Published On 06 Apr 2020 , 04:08 PM

The RBA bought the entire A$2 billion it offered to purchase today, focusing mainly on May 2028 bond. The cut-off yield was slightly higher in line with the rise in yields in the market today.
